About the role
- Install, update, and maintain SQL Server database software across multiple versions (2012–2022).
- Manage database performance by developing protocols, monitoring systems, and resolving processing and programming issues.
- Implement database security policies and disaster recovery (DR) procedures to ensure data integrity and accessibility.
- Support database migrations from on-premises to cloud environments, with a focus on Azure databases and SQL in cloud/Azure.
- Design, implement, and maintain highly available and performant SQL Server and MySQL database systems.
- Monitor database health, performance, and capacity using industry-standard tools and custom scripts.
- Automate routine database operations and deployments using Infrastructure as Code (IaC) and CI/CD pipelines.
- Upgrade SQL Server versions and optimize systems for performance and reliability.
- Create and optimize queries, stored procedures, and indexing strategies.
- Maintain and administer SSAS, SSIS, and SSRS solutions for reporting and analytics.
- Provide guidance and support to developers, including schema design, code review, and query tuning.
- Collaborate with DevOps to install, configure, and manage SQL Server instances and databases in hybrid environments.
- Design, deploy, and maintain SQL Server availability groups across data centers.
- Develop and maintain database standards, documentation, and failover runbooks.
- Automate database maintenance tasks and processes to improve efficiency.
- Be available for on-call support to address urgent database issues.
Requirements
- Proven experience with SQL Server (2012–2022), Azure databases, and SQL on VMs.
- 3+ years of Terraform/Ansible/Powershell experience
- Experience with Azure SQL, Azure Managed Instances, and on-prem SQL Server.
- Hands-on experience with disaster recovery (DR) solutions for SQL Server.
- Expertise in SSAS, SSIS, and SSRS, with exposure to Power BI preferred.
- Demonstrated ability to migrate on-premises databases to cloud environments, including Azure.
- Strong skills in updating SQL Server versions and implementing new database systems.
- Proficiency in SQL query language, query optimization, and troubleshooting.
- Strong experience with PowerShell scripting for automation and configuration management.
- Exposure to Infrastructure as Code (IaC) tools, such as Terraform, Ansible, or ARM templates.
- Advanced knowledge of database security, performance tuning, and backup/recovery standards.
- Familiarity with dimensional and relational data modeling concepts.
- Strong programming skills, including experience with PL/SQL coding.
- Experience with Unix and PowerShell scripting for database management tasks.
- Knowledge of emerging database technologies and the ability to recommend and implement solutions.
- Excellent problem-solving skills and attention to detail.
- Strong communication skills to collaborate effectively with technical and non-technical teams.
